Weston St, Harris Park NSW 2150
Weston St, Harris Park NSW 2150 is a predominantly apartment-focused street with a small house presence. 5 homes sit above the street; 8 homes sit level with the street; 5 homes sit below the street. 18 homes are heritage-listed and 4 are recommended for a flood check. There are insufficient recent house sales to calculate a reliable comparison against the suburb. 71 Weston St has 12 lots across 3 levels built in 1988, 52 Weston St has 12 lots across 3 levels built in 2002, and 82 Weston St has 12 lots across 2 levels built in 2005.

What are the risk and overlay factors on Weston St?
There are no bushfire or high-voltage powerline overlays on Weston St. One property sits within a heritage listing, which typically means renovations, extensions, or exterior changes may require additional council approval, reducing renovation flexibility. Four properties are recommended for a flood check, meaning further assessment is advised. Sixteen properties fall under other flood classifications, indicating no flood risk identified or not mapped. A flood overlay or recommended flood check does not necessarily mean a property floods, but it is worth reviewing council mapping, flood reports and insurance costs before purchasing.

Is Weston St mostly houses or apartments?
There are 262 residential properties on Weston St. Houses make up 7.6% of the residential stock, while apartments account for 64.5%. The street is predominantly apartments.

How many properties have sold on Weston St?
5 apartments have sold in the past 12 months on Weston St, while no houses have sold. The 5-year turnover rate for houses is 10%, and for apartments, it is 16%. Turnover measures the proportion of properties that changed ownership during the past five years.
